Libertad wins a thrilling match against Delfín SC
Loja, Ecuador – Libertad defeated Delfín SC 2-0 in a thrilling match at the Estadio Federativo Reina del Cisne. The game was marked by the expulsion of a Delfín SC player, as well as numerous scoring opportunities from both teams.
In the 35th minute, Luis Castro received a direct red card for a foul on a Libertad player. Delfín SC was forced to play with ten men for most of the match.
Despite the numerical disadvantage, Delfín SC stayed in the game. The first half ended goalless, but Libertad took the lead in the 40th minute when Nicolás Molina scored after an assist from Germán Mina.
Libertad increased their lead in the 52nd minute when Iván Zambrano scored the second goal after an assist from Elvis Caicedo.
Delfín SC couldn’t find a way back into the game and Libertad managed to maintain their lead until the end of the match.
Statistics:
Libertad: 62% possession, 18 shots (9 on target, 8 off target), 6 corners, 10 fouls, 0 yellows, 0 reds
Delfín SC: 38% possession, 13 shots (5 on target, 6 off target), 5 corners, 6 fouls, 2 yellows, 1 red
